CINCINNATI, OH: In partnership with the Ohio History Connection, the Harriet Beecher Stowe House in Walnut Hills began welcoming visitors again Thursday, June 18, 2020.

Guided tours are available by appointment, generally from 10am-4pm Thursdays-Saturdays and Sundays 12pm-4pm.  Visitors can make an appointment by filling out a form on the www.stowehousecincy.org website or by calling the museum at 513-751-0651. Each tour is customized to the special interests of the visitors and children are welcome. Contactless payment is preferred, but cash will also be accepted. Admission is $6 for adults, $5 for college students and seniors, and $3 for ages 6-17. Ages 5 and under are free. The admission fee is waived for members of the Friends of Harriet Beecher Stowe House and members of the Ohio History Connection. 

All volunteers and staff will be wearing face coverings to protect visitors during their visit. We strongly encourage guests to return the favor and will have disposable masks available if needed. The museum’s capacity is currently two family groups. Each group will be no larger than 9. Groups will be on a staggered tour schedule so that they do not interact and will remain more than 6 feet apart. When you arrive, your guide will ask you to affirm your current state of health and that you do not have a cough or tightening in the chest, and that no one else in your household is ill.
